#0ee62c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0ee62c is composed of 5.5% red, 90.2%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.9%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 128.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 47.8%. #0ee62c color hex could be obtained by blending #1cff58 with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

● #0ee62c color description : Vivid lime green.
#0ee62c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0ee62c has RGB values of R:14, G:230,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 976428.
